NATO Jets Shoot Down Drone Over Latvia, Which Blames ‘Russian Electromagnetic Warfare’
NATO jets have shot down another drone which spilled over into Baltic territory from the Ukraine war, Latvia’s defense ministry announced Friday.
The fresh incident happened over eastern Latvian airspace on Friday. NATO “fighter jets have successfully shot down a foreign unmanned aerial vehicle that had entered Latvia as a result of Russian electromagnetic warfare,” the ministry stated on X.
“The drone was destroyed over the Balvi region by aircraft taking part in NATO’s Baltic Air patrol mission,” CNBC wrote based on the military statement. Further, “Latvia said airspace alerts were issued across several eastern and southern regions and lifted at 4:50 a.m. local time.”
It was only described as “a foreign unmanned aerial vehicle” that had “flown into Latvia as a result of Russian electromagnetic warfare,” the translated statement said.
The reference suggests that Russian forces may have jammed and/or taken control of a Ukrainian drone, and sent it across the border. Just measures have become common for intercepting UAVs on the Ukrainian battlefield.
Latvian Prime Minister Andris Kulbergs hailed the military’s swift response on X, saying, “This is a confirmation that Latvian airspace is protected,” and added: “At the same time, such incidents remind us that we must continue to strengthen the surveillance and anti-drone capabilities of Latvia’s eastern border in order to be able to detect, identify and neutralize any potential threat as quickly as possible.”
Nearby Finland took drastic safety measures as a result of the incident:
Baltic Sea neighbor Finland also imposed temporary aviation and maritime restrictions in the eastern Gulf of Finland on Friday, its defense forces said on X.
It described the move as a precautionary measure aimed at ensuring the safety of bystanders and the operational capabilities of authorities to counter potential drones. Hours later, the governor of Russia’s northwest Leningrad region said air defences had shot down 54 Ukrainian drones.
There have been at least a half-dozen significant drone incursion incidents over the Baltic nations over just the past year, often resulting in fighter jets being scrambled. For Latvia this is at least the second recent major shootdown incident.

There have been other repeat drone incidents in Europe, for example the spate of mystery UAV sightings over Northern and Western Europe. In some cases they’ve shut down airports. With these, it’s anyone’s guess as to the origins.
Some pundits have suggested these are merely irresponsible hobbyists, or else pranksters. However, the reality of projectiles entering neighboring countries as a result of the Ukraine war is much more serious, and a significant threat to these populations.
